> An explicit check for address registers was not required so far since
> during register allocation the processing of address constraints was
> sufficient.  However, address constraints themself do not check for
> REGNO_OK_FOR_{BASE,INDEX}_P.  Thus, with the newly introduced
> late-combine pass in r15-1579-g792f97b44ffc5e we generate new insns with
> invalid address registers which aren't fixed up afterwards.
> 
> Fixed by explicitly checking for address registers in
> s390_decompose_addrstyle_without_index such that those new insns are
> rejected.
> 
> gcc/ChangeLog:
> 
>       target/PR115634
>       * config/s390/s390.cc (s390_decompose_addrstyle_without_index):
>       Check for ADDR_REGS in s390_decompose_addrstyle_without_index.
